{"product_id":"personalized-class-of-2026-crewneck-sweatshirt","title":"Personalized Class of 2026 Crewneck Sweatshirt","description":"\u003ctable id=\"size-guide\" style=\"min-width:360px;\"\u003e\n            \u003cthead\u003e\n                \u003ctr\u003e\n                    \u003cth style=\"padding:10px;\"\u003e\u003c\/th\u003e\n                    \u003cth style=\"color:#000000;font-weight:500;text-align:left;font-size:15px;padding:10px;\"\u003eS\u003c\/th\u003e\n\u003cth style=\"color:#000000;font-weight:500;text-align:left;font-size:15px;padding:10px;\"\u003eM\u003c\/th\u003e\n\u003cth style=\"color:#000000;font-weight:500;text-align:left;font-size:15px;padding:10px;\"\u003eL\u003c\/th\u003e\n\u003cth style=\"color:#000000;font-weight:500;text-align:left;font-size:15px;padding:10px;\"\u003eXL\u003c\/th\u003e\n\u003cth style=\"color:#000000;font-weight:500;text-align:left;font-size:15px;padding:10px;\"\u003e2XL\u003c\/th\u003e\n\u003cth style=\"color:#000000;font-weight:500;text-align:left;font-size:15px;padding:10px;\"\u003e3XL\u003c\/th\u003e\n\u003cth style=\"color:#000000;font-weight:500;text-align:left;font-size:15px;padding:10px;\"\u003e4XL\u003c\/th\u003e\n                \u003c\/tr\u003e\n            \u003c\/thead\u003e\n            \u003ctbody\u003e\n                \n                    \u003ctr\u003e\n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            Width, in\n                        \u003c\/td\u003e\n                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            20.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            22.01 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            24.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            26.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            28.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            30.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            32.00 \n                        \u003c\/td\u003e\n                                        \n                    \u003c\/tr\u003e\n               \n                    \u003ctr\u003e\n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            Length, in\n                        \u003c\/td\u003e\n                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            27.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            28.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            29.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            30.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            31.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            32.00 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            33.00 \n                        \u003c\/td\u003e\n                                        \n                    \u003c\/tr\u003e\n               \n                    \u003ctr\u003e\n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            Sleeve length (from center back), in\n                        \u003c\/td\u003e\n                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            33.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            34.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            35.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            36.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            37.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            38.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            39.50 \n                        \u003c\/td\u003e\n                                        \n                    \u003c\/tr\u003e\n               \n                    \u003ctr\u003e\n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            Size tolerance, in\n                        \u003c\/td\u003e\n                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            1.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            1.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            1.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            1.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            1.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            1.50 \n                        \u003c\/td\u003e\n                                        \n                        \u003ctd style=\"padding:10px;color:#525252;font-size:15px;border-top:1px solid #ededed;word-break: break-word;\"\u003e\n                            1.50 \n                        \u003c\/td\u003e\n                                        \n                    \u003c\/tr\u003e\n               \n            \u003c\/tbody\u003e\n        \u003c\/table\u003e\n        \u003cp\u003eA soft, dependable crewneck that carries hometown pride without shouting. This medium-weight sweatshirt feels like a familiar hug—slightly structured at the shoulders, plush through the body, and finished with a ribbed collar and cuffs that keep their shape. The front features a collegiate-style college crest and “Class of 2026” embroidery that reads like a quiet badge of accomplishment. Subtle printed details at the inner neck and faint back lettering add layered, personal touches. Built from a 50\/50 cotton-poly blend (Heather Sport blends vary) and knit without side seams, it drapes smoothly and resists pilling. Safe, ethically sourced materials and OEKO-TEX certified dyes mean you can wear it confidently, season after season.\u003c\/p\u003e\u003cp\u003e\u003c\/p\u003e\u003cp\u003eProduct features\u003c\/p\u003e\u003cp\u003e- Embroidered university crest and ‘Class of 2026’ on center chest; optional wrist embroidery\u003c\/p\u003e\u003cp\u003e- 50\/50 cotton-poly medium-weight (8.0 oz\/yd²) knit for warmth and durability\u003c\/p\u003e\u003cp\u003e- Tubular knit construction (no side seams) for a smooth, waste-reducing finish\u003c\/p\u003e\u003cp\u003e- Ribbed knit collar and double-needle stitching for long-lasting shape retention\u003c\/p\u003e\u003cp\u003e- Ethically sourced US cotton, OEKO-TEX certified dyes, and safety compliance\u003c\/p\u003e\u003cp\u003e\u003c\/p\u003e\u003cp\u003eCare instructions\u003c\/p\u003e\u003cp\u003e- Machine wash: cold (max 30C or 90F)\u003c\/p\u003e\u003cp\u003e- Non-chlorine: bleach as needed\u003c\/p\u003e\u003cp\u003e- Tumble dry: low heat\u003c\/p\u003e\u003cp\u003e- Do not dryclean\u003c\/p\u003e\u003cp\u003e- \u003c\/p\u003e","brand":"Printify","offers":[{"title":"Dark Heather \/ S","offer_id":53109939143021,"sku":"43887409476626260579","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sand \/ S","offer_id":53109939175789,"sku":"27857239355803236098","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sport Grey \/ S","offer_id":53109939208557,"sku":"17929955680401231425","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Black \/ S","offer_id":53109939241325,"sku":"90311863794809657139","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Forest Green \/ S","offer_id":53109939274093,"sku":"16896473566875995719","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Dark Heather \/ M","offer_id":53109939306861,"sku":"11032349170554674091","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sand \/ M","offer_id":53109939339629,"sku":"23044037519259987328","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sport Grey \/ M","offer_id":53109939372397,"sku":"13164614501323242406","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Black \/ M","offer_id":53109939405165,"sku":"17580766969778756104","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Forest Green \/ M","offer_id":53109939437933,"sku":"40180185549164609538","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Dark Heather \/ L","offer_id":53109939470701,"sku":"33645347095163810246","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sand \/ L","offer_id":53109939503469,"sku":"32099846728808996716","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sport Grey \/ L","offer_id":53109939536237,"sku":"31158184029866246223","price":45.0,"currency_code":"USD","in_stock":true},{"title":"White \/ L","offer_id":53109939569005,"sku":"99461663175471314889","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Black \/ L","offer_id":53109939601773,"sku":"28125855998404196553","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Forest Green \/ L","offer_id":53109939634541,"sku":"14618641248681628400","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Dark Heather \/ XL","offer_id":53109939667309,"sku":"58821366968577432747","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sand \/ XL","offer_id":53109939700077,"sku":"13810126473274791905","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sport Grey \/ XL","offer_id":53109939732845,"sku":"17626866162925226937","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Black \/ XL","offer_id":53109939765613,"sku":"27796709456689100336","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Forest Green \/ XL","offer_id":53109939798381,"sku":"19940463729531173979","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Dark Heather \/ 2XL","offer_id":53109939831149,"sku":"70785558358205250124","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sand \/ 2XL","offer_id":53109939863917,"sku":"30089014765582985502","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sport Grey \/ 2XL","offer_id":53109939896685,"sku":"59781144696809797273","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Black \/ 2XL","offer_id":53109939929453,"sku":"21956666303831094303","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Forest Green \/ 2XL","offer_id":53109939962221,"sku":"26234385654286329257","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Sand \/ 3XL","offer_id":53109939994989,"sku":"14787949317146813653","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Black \/ 3XL","offer_id":53109940027757,"sku":"10540950003257077341","price":45.0,"currency_code":"USD","in_stock":true},{"title":"Black \/ 4XL","offer_id":53109940060525,"sku":"26272204419024959769","price":45.0,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0968\/8612\/9005\/files\/7182777835708391886_2048.jpg?v=1773265129","url":"https:\/\/palmandstoneco.myshopify.com\/products\/personalized-class-of-2026-crewneck-sweatshirt","provider":"Palm \u0026 Stone Co. ","version":"1.0","type":"link"}